Online Resources Is Recognized

CHANTILLY, Texas-Online Resources Corp. has won a Collection Technology Excellence Award from Collection Technology News based on peer nominations and for pioneering self-resolution technology for its web-based collections service. Online Resources officials say it offers a branded, round-the-clock service where delinquent account holders can solve their own problems.

Three CUs Select WRG

PASADENA, Calif.-Three credit unions have signed on with Wescom Resources Group to use its ATM deposit balancing solution. The three credit unions are California CU, Fresno FCU and the Los Angeles Police FCU, which combined experience more than 30,000 ATM deposits per month. WRG works with 25 CUs around the nation and processes nearly 300,000 ATM deposits each month.

Metavante Adds Doc Imaging

WAYNE, Penn.-Metavante Corp. is now offering document image technology as part of its loan origination system and point-of-sale solutions. Image capture will allow credit unions to add, view and manage documents in order to streamline loan origination.

Kirchman, SecureWorks Partner

ATLANTA-Kirchman Corp. said it will offer managed IT security through a partnership with SecureWorks and resell SecureWorks' managed security services to its clients. SecureWorks offers round-the-clock network intrusion prevention, vulnerability assessment, phishing prevention and encrypted email among other services.

AppOne, Wolters Kluwer Team Up

BATON ROUGE, La.-Internet technology provider AppOne formed a partnership with Wolters Kluwer Financial Services to use its Bankers Systems brand for loan documentation and lender forms. The application documents can be printed directly from the desktop, which helps to reduce common errors from text or paper misalignment, according to the company.
